How much does Intracranial Hemorrhage Procedures (with CC) cost?

$107,152

Typical facility fee. In Wyoming, July 2026.

Insurers have agreed to pay about $107,152 for this service. Most negotiated rates run $69,183 to $123,027.

Few insurers publish rates for this combination, so treat this figure as a rough guide.

These are rates insurers have negotiated with providers, not the amount a patient is billed. What you owe depends on your plan's deductible and coinsurance. Based on rates published by 3 insurance carriers under federal price transparency rules.
